Management Commentary

In the recent earnings call for the first quarter of 2026, AngloGold Ashanti’s management highlighted the company’s solid performance, with reported earnings per share of $2.51. Executives attributed this result to disciplined cost management and steady production across key operations, noting that the company benefited from a supportive gold price environment during the period. Management emphasized operational stability, pointing to consistent output from its mining complexes and progress in optimizing underground and open-pit activities. Among the key drivers, the company cited ongoing efficiency improvements at South American operations and successful ramp-up efforts at certain sites, which helped offset challenges such as inflationary pressures on consumables and labor. While revenue figures were not separately disclosed, management indicated that gross margin improvements were supported by higher realized gold prices compared to the preceding quarter. Looking ahead, the team expressed cautious optimism about sustaining operational momentum, though they acknowledged potential headwinds from currency fluctuations and supply chain constraints. No specific forward guidance was provided, but management reiterated a commitment to maintaining cost discipline and advancing portfolio optimization initiatives. Forward Guidance

Looking ahead, AngloGold Ashanti’s forward guidance reflects a cautiously optimistic stance following the Q1 2026 earnings release, which showed EPS of $2.51. Management indicated that operational momentum from the first quarter could continue, supported by ongoing efficiency initiatives and stable production volumes. The company anticipates that full-year production may align with its earlier targets, contingent on maintaining cost control and avoiding major disruptions at key mines. Gold price volatility remains a key variable in the outlook. AngloGold expects that if current price levels persist, cash flow generation could remain robust, potentially funding further debt reduction or selective growth projects. However, management also noted that inflationary pressures on input costs—such as labor and consumables—might partially offset any price benefits. The company’s growth expectations are anchored in its project pipeline, including expansion work at its African and Australian operations. While no specific production or cost guidance for future quarters was provided, the tone suggested that steady-state output is achievable with disciplined capital allocation. Analysts will closely monitor cost trends and any updates on development timelines in upcoming disclosures. Overall, the guidance emphasizes measured optimism, with a focus on operational reliability rather than aggressive expansion. Market Reaction

The market reacted positively to AngloGold Ashanti's (AU) recently released first-quarter 2026 results. The company reported earnings per share of $2.51, which came in ahead of consensus expectations in a period marked by elevated gold prices. Shares moved higher in the sessions following the announcement, with trading volume notably above average, reflecting renewed investor interest in the gold mining names amid ongoing macroeconomic uncertainty. Analysts noted that the solid earnings print underscores operational efficiency improvements and favorable cost management, even as revenue figures were not separately disclosed. A handful of brokerages raised their near-term outlooks for the stock, citing the potential for continued margin expansion if gold prices remain supportive. However, some caution was expressed regarding possible headwinds from rising input costs and fluctuating currency exchange rates. Overall, the market appears to be pricing in a more constructive view on AngloGold’s ability to deliver against production targets, while still monitoring global demand dynamics and central bank buying patterns. The earnings release has helped stabilize sentiment around the stock after a period of mixed price action earlier this year.
